85 D100, no running lights

I replaced the fuse in my truck that controls the running lights but after a few minutes it blew the fuse. I tried to put another fuse in it but it sparked and melted the bottom of the fuse. Im not very good with electrical but what should I check before having to take it to a mechanic to have it fixed?
